All 827 terms

TermDefinition
tenderv. to offer formally; n. a legal tender; something, esp. money, offered in payment
decryv. to speak out against strongly or openly
capriciousadj. erratic; tending to change abruptly
referendumn. direct popular vote on a law or measure of public policy
covenantn. a binding agreement
dapperadj. neat and trim in appearance
slovenlyadj. careless about one's own appearance
remonstratev. to make objections
candorn. frankness or sincerity of expression
becomev. to be appropriate or suitable to; to look good with
couchv. to phrase in a particular way
eclatn. great brilliance, as of performance or achievement; conspicuous success
comelyadj. attractive or pleasing in appearance; pretty; handsome
cruxn. an essential or pivotal point; a perplexing difficulty
fathomv. to measure the depth of; to understand
supplantv. to take the place of
prosaicadj. straightforward; lacking in imagination
disconcertv. to make confused or uneasy
penchantadj. a strong liking
intersticesn. small spaces between things
ecclesiasticaladj. relating to the church
ostentatiousadj. showy; pretentious
deferencen. yielding an opinion, desire, or position to another out of respect
palpableadj. capable of being handled, touched , or felt; easily perceived
lassituden. a feeling of weakness
charyadj. very cautious
homelyadj. unattractive, plain looking
posterityn. future generations
shaden. a small variation, a nuance; a small amount
maverickone who rebels; a nonconformist; an individualist
piquantadj. agreeably pungent or sharp in taste; tart; agreeably stimulating or interesting
canardn. a false report
elysianadj. heavenly or delightful
obsequiousadj. showing too great a willingness to serve or obey
bulwarkn. a wall or embankment used for a defensive fortification; something serving as a defense or safeguard, oft. figurative
innocuousadj. harmless
amalgamatev. to blend together into one; to unite
vociferousadj. loud and vehement
latituden. freedom from normal limitations; room for movement or action
puerileadj. childlike
rambunctiousadj. very loud and disorderly
prognosticatev. to predict
augustadj. inspiring awe or admiration, esp. because of high rank or character
furrown. a trench in the earth made by a plow; a wrinkle
lineamentsn. any of the features of the body, usually the face
scintillatev. to give off sparks; to be animated or briliant
scionn. an heir; a descendant
svelteadj. slender and graceful in outline
flowerv. to reach the best or most vigorous stage
beleagueredadj. harassed; besieged
quixoticadj. foolishly idealistic; extravagantly chivalrous
preemptv. to take place of; to have priority or precedence over
sinecuren. a paid position that requires little or no work
egregiousadj. outstanding for undesirable qualities; remarkably bad
desultoryadj. lacking a plan or purpose; unmethodical
visceraladj. instinctive; relating to the internal organs
consecratev. to make or set apart as sacred
tantamountadj. equivalent in effect or value
exoneratev. to find blameless
manifestadj. obvious; very clear; evident
mienn. bearing or manner, esp. as revealing one's inner state of mind
rancidadj. spoiled or rotten (esp. oils or fats)
embroilv. to engage in trouble; to complicate
insidiousadj. subtly harmful; stealthy, sneaky
waggishadj. mischievous; playful
proteanadj. easily taking on different forms
malingerv. to act sick in order to avoid work
waifn. a person without home or friends
occultadj. relating to the supernatural; beyond human comprehension; mysterious
melangen. a mixture; a hodgepodge
morassn. an area of swampy ground; something that hinders
vicariousadj. felt as if one were taking part in the experiences of another
rancorousadj. bitter and resentful
regalev. to delight or entertain
effectv. to bring about
leavenv. to add yeast; to fill (something) with a substance that changes it or makes it lighter
inordinateadj. excessive, unrestrained
polyglotadj. speaking many languages; n. one who speaks many languages
vapidadj. lacking interest, animation or flavor
sublimeadj. of high spritual or moral worth
roten. mechanical memorization, oft. without full understanding
denouementn. conclusion; resolution; the falling action of a story after its climax
germaneadj. fitting and appropriate
commiseratev. to express sympathy
procurev. to obtain or acquire
atrophyn. wasting away, esp. of body tissue
imbuev. to inspire; to permeate; to fill with a mood or tone
relegatev. to assign to an obscure place or condition; to send away
fulminatev. to issue a strong verbal attack
abetv. to encourage, assist, or support, usually in wrongdoing
canvassv. to ask for votes, opinions, etc.; to examine or discuss in detail
fortituden. strength of mind that allows one to endure adversity
exudev. to give off; to emit; to radiate
bathosn. excessive or trivial sentimentality; and abrupt transition in style from the elevated to the commonplace, producing a laughable effect
contumaciousadj. stubbornly disobedient; rebellious; insubordinate
confluencen. joining together of different streams
luridadj. causing shock or horror; tastelessly vivid; glowing like fire through a haze
redressv. to set right; to remedy
bromiden. commonplace remark intended to calm; platitude
approbationn. official approval
curtailv. to cut short, abbreviate
congenitaladj. present since birth; being an essential characteristic
reticencen. the quality or state of being silent or uncommunicative
verisimilituden. resemblance to the truth
hegemoneyn. strong influence; domination
shibbolethn. a custom or phrase distinctive of a particular group, class, etc.
parochialadj. restricted; limited; narrow; local
doctrinaireadj. inflexibly maintaining an idea without regard to practically
ilkn. kind; sort; class
multifariousadj. having many different parts or forms; numerous and varied
licentiousadj. not moral; lawless; lewd
halcyonadj. calm; peaceful
grislyadj. inspiring horror because of appalling crudity or inhumanity; gruesome
gregariousadj. seeking and enjoying the company of others; tending to move in a group
implicatev. to inscriminate; to show or suggest involvement
concertedadj. planned or accomplished together
deleteriousadj. harmful; destructive
impugnv. to challenge; call into question
fatuousadj. smugly foolish; complacently stupid
exiguousadj. scanty; meager; small; slender
vagaryn. an erratic notion or action
kindredadj. related or similar in origin or nature
caveatn. a warning
forebearn. a person from whom one is descended; an ancestor (usu. plural)
rococoadj. elaborate or overdone
itinerantadj. traveling from place to place, esp. for work
efficacyn. the power to produce the desired effect
facetiousadj. playfully humorous
incessantadj. never pausing; continuous; without a stop
incurv. to acquire or sustain something undesirable
nuancen. variation of meaning; subtlety
onusn. an unpleasant task or duty; a burden or obligation
heraldv. to bear news; to announce
reliquaryn. a receptacle (such as a shrine) for displaying relics
abscondv. to go away hastily and secretively; to hide
abackadv. by surprise
timorousadj. full of fear
promulgatev. to make known by official announcement
improvidentadj. not preparing for the future; incautious
temerityadj. willingness to do or say something that shocks or upsets people
balkv. to stop short and refuse to continue
capaciousadj. able to contain or hold much
accedev. to agree to something
eclecticadj. composed of material from various sources
exigentadj. requiring immediate action
piquev. to arouse (interest, curiosity, etc.); to irritate
loquaciousadj. very talkative
enormityn. great wickedness; an evil act
avocationn. hobby
compassn. area; range; scope
progenitorn. a direct ancestor
behoovev. to be necessary or proper for
cabaln. a small group of secret plotters, i.e., against a government or authority
vacillatev. to swing back and forth
tenuousadj. weak; thin
paradigmn. an example; a model
delineatev. to draw the outline of; describe in words or gestures
emollientadj. having a softening, smoothing effect; n. an agent that softens, esp. the skin
exultv. to rejoice greatly
adducev. to show as an example or means of proving something
acumenn. quickness and accuracy of judgement or insight
heterodoxadj. not in agreement with accepted beliefs, esp. religious dogma
entrenchedadj. dug in
prerogativen. an exclusive right or privelege, esp. one that is the result of hereditary or official position
ramificationn. a development or consequence resulting from a course of action
propitiousadj. presenting favorable circumstances
empiricaladj. based on experience rather than a theory
tepidadj. moderately warm; lacking force or enthusiasim
equivocaladj. capable of multiple interpretations; unclear
argotn. specialized vocabulary unique to a particular group
hermeticadj. completely sealed, esp. from entry or escape of air
speciousadj. seeming to be truthful on the surface, but actually false
reciprocatev. to give something in return
gaucheadj. socially awkward
broachv. to raise for discussion
equanimityn. evenness of temper, esp. as a characteristic state
adumbratev. to give a sketchy outline; to foreshadow
expatriatev. to send into exile; n. one who has moved to a foreign country
construev. to interpret
reconditeadj. not easily understood
emolumentn. payment for an office or employment
anatheman. someone or something that is hatred
inexorableadj. not able to be persuaded; unyielding; unalterable
expungev. to erase; to eliminate completely
symposiumn. a meeting to discuss a topic, esp. where the participants form the audience and make presentations
hiatusn. an interruption in activity or progress
subterfugen. a sneaky or devious method for avoiding difficulty or unpleasantness
intimatev. to make known subtly; to hint
jingoismn. an extreme patriotism
clandestineadj. done in secret, esp. to conceal something improper
onerousadj. burdensome, hard to bear
polemicn. a controversial argument, esp. attacking a particular opinion
bravuran. a showy display
stigman. a sign of disgrace; a mark that lowers a reputation
sedulousadj. working hard and steadily; diligent
surreptitiousadj. done secretly, often of something unseemly or unethical
passeadj. old fashioned; out-of-style
nascentadj. coming into being; being born
panacean. a cure-all or an all-purpose solution
renegaden. someone who rejects one group, cause,or allegiance for another
prurientadj. tending to have or cause lustful thoughts
punitiveadj. inflicting or intended to inflict punishment
abjurev. to renounce under oath; to give up or deny
mandarinn. a high government official; a member of an elite group, esp. having high status in intellectual or cultural circles
sardonicadj. bitterly sneezing; mocking; sarcastic
patentadj. obvious; evident
valedictoryn. a farewell speech
indictv. to formally accuse of criminal activity
estuaryn. the part of a river that meets a sea
interdictv. to forbid or stop the activities or entry of
extraditev. to deliver someone (e.g., a fugitive) to the authority of another government or jurisdiction
vernacularn. informal speech; native language
dissemblev. to deceive or conceal; to hide one's motives; to simulate
dappledadj. spotted
quackn. an untrained person who pretends to be a physician and dispenses medical advice and treatment
harrowingadj. very distressing; painful
mercenaryadj. greedy; motivated by desire for money
self-abnegationn. the putting aside of personal interest for the sake of others
reprehensibleadj. deserving to be severely criticized
secretev. to put or keep in a hiding place; to conceal
opprobriumn. bad reputation or disgrace gained after a specific action
stentoriann. extremely loud
pervadev. to spread through, or be present throughout
parsimonyn. excessive care in spending; stinginess
sententiousadj. expressing much in few words; given to pompous moralizing
reverien. daydream
resignv. to accept a bad situation
pantheonn. all the gods of a people; a group highly respected in a field
marqueen. a sign over the entrance to a public building
consortv. to associate; to keep company
biliousadj. bad-tempered; cross
amuckadj. frenzied, esp. violently
seguen. an easy, effective, or uninterrupted transition
lummoxn. a clumsy person
sanguineadj. optimistic, cheerful
condignadj. deserved (usu. of punishment)
gratuitousadj. unnecessary or inappropriate
saturnineadj. of a gloomy temperament
ruminatev. to ponder at length
ersatzadj. inferior imitation or substitute
mettlecourage; strength of character
parrotv. to blindly repeat or copy
umbragen. offense; resentment
gaudyadj. characterized by tasteless or showy colors
pedanticadj. putting unnecessary stress on minor or purely academic knowledge
perspicaciousadj. having keen perception or understanding
somnolentadj. sleepy
primaten. a bishop of highest rank in a country or province
travestyn. an imitation that makes a serious thing seem ridiculous
rhapsodyn. a state of great happiness; such a state expressed in speech or writing
moribundadj. approaching death; nearly obsolete
overwroughtadj. extremely nervous or excited
ulterioradj. lying beyond what is evident, revealed, or claimed
edictn. an authoritative order issued publicly; a decree
cholericadj. easily angered; bad-tempered
extemporaneousadj. done with little or no preparation
peccadillon. a minor sin
jaundicen. prejudice; bias; a yellowish discoloration of the skin
phlegmaticadj. having a calm, sluggish temperament; unemotional
subsidyn. monetary assistance
ineffableadj. incapable of being expressed
histrionicadj. overly dramatic, theatrical
rejoinderv. to answer, esp. to another answer
raucousadj. loud and harsh
forten. something at which a person excels
recapitulatev. to summarize; to paraphrase
rectituden. conduct according to moral principles
eschewv. to avoid; to shun
nonpareiladj. having no equal
debasev. to make lower in value, quality, or character
scourgen. a cause of widespread suffering
internecineadj. pertaining to conflict within a group; mutually destructive
maximn. a short saying expressing a general principle
railv. to speak bitterly or reproachfully
culpableadj. deserving blame or punishment
acquiescev. to agree without protest
ad hocadj. for a specific purpose and no other; improvised
lugubriousadj. sad or mouthful, esp. in a way that seems exxagerated or ridiculous
menagerien. a collection of wild and strange animals kept in cages
rapturen. the experience of great joy; ecstacy
proclivityn. a natural or habitual tendency or inclination
fortuitousadj. occuring by chance
truculentadj. inclined to fight; expressing violence or hostility
refractoryadj. stubbornly resistant to control, authority, or treatment
sycophantn. one who seeks favor by flatteing people of wealth or influence
recreantadj. showing faithless disloyalty; n. a disloyal coward
propensityn. a natural inclination; a tendency
tractableadj. easily managed or controlled
impalpableadj. that which cannot be felt by touching; not easily understood
ad infinitumadv. lasting forever; continuously
interlopern. one who interferes with the affairs of others; a meddler
ascribev. to attribute to a specific source
encomiumn. high praise
abasev. to lower in rank or prestige
aspersionn. a remark that attacks one's reputation
defunctadj. having ceased to exist or live
ostensibleadj. outwardly appearing as such
bifurcatev. to divide into two parts
exculpatev. to clear from blame or guilt
avaricen. excessive desire for wealth
upshotn. the decisive or final result
nondescriptadj. lacking distinction or individual character
incongruousadj. lacking agreement; incompatible
effronteryn. bold and insulting behavior
antediluvianadj. very old; outdated
aboveboardadj. without dishonesty or concealment
vacuousadj. lacking substance or intelligence
haplessadj. unfortunate; unlucky
affableadj. friendly; easy to talk to
accostv. to approach and speak to, usually aggressive
tumultn. a great commotion or uproar
conceitn. a fanciful idea or image, esp. an exxagerated poetic comparison; an extravagant construction
bereavedadj. suffering the loss of a loved one
positv. to assume as a fact or principle
covenn. a group of witches, usually 13
arrogatev. to claim for one's self unjustly
corpsn. a group of persons working together or related by a common association
abrogatev. to cancel or repeal by authority
exuberantadj. lively, happy, full of good spirits
engenderv. to beget; to cause; to promote
heinousadj. extremely wicked; abominable
abradev. to wear down a surface by or as if by scraping
quid pro quon. an equal exchange or substitution
goadn. a long stick used to prod animals; something used to urge on; v. to prod or urge, as if with a pointed stick
staunchadj. strongly loyal
zeitgeistn. the trend or spirit of the times
fastidiousadj. not easy to please; very critical or discriminating
trucklev. to submit in a subservient manner to a superior; fawn
abatev. to lessen in amount, intensity or strength
surrogaten. substitute
vindictiveadj. seeking revenge; marked by a desire to hurt
benedictionn. blessing
disarmingadj. reducing or preventing critism with charm
expoundv. to explain in detail
vertiginousadj. causing dizziness, as from spinning or heights
effervescentadj. giving off gas bubbles; showing high spirits or excitement
cantankerousadj. bad-tempered; quarrelsome
floridadj. flushed with rosy color; over decorated
purportv. to claim, esp. falsely
derelictadj. abandoned; negligent
carte blanchen. unrestricted power to act at one's own discretion
temporizev. to act evasively in order to gain time
wizenedadj. wrinkled from aging
quirkn. a rapid twist and turn; an indivisual mannerism
watershedn. a critical point that marks a division
zephyrn. a gentle, soft breeze
byzantineadj. highly complicated or intricate; characterized by devious plotting
convalescev. to recover from illness; to recuperate
holisticadj. dealing with something as a whole rather than by its indivisual parts
parisann. a strong, often militant, supporter
coterien. a small, often exclusive group of people who associate with one another frequently
corroboratev. to strengthen; comfort; support
predilectionn. a preference
bawdyadj. indecent or humorously coarse; lewd
cardinaladj. of main importance; principal
diurnaladj. daily; occuring during the daytime
proscribev. to prohibit or forbid; to denounce
fomentv. to stir up negative feelings, esp. those that lead to violent action
demagoguen. a leader who obtains power by appealing to the emotions and passions of otherst
dictumn. an authroitative, often formal, pronouncement
renumeratev. to pay or compensate
debonairadj. easy and carefree in manner
knellv. to ring in a slow solemn way; n. the sound of a bell, esp. of one run at a funeral; an omen of death, failure, etc.
finessen. subtle skill in performance or in handling a situation
cadren. a group of trained, highly skilled people of training others
fractiousadj. disruptive or irritable
pittancen. a small amount, esp. of money
sang-froidn. coolness and composure, esp. in difficult circumstances
incumbentadj. necessary or obligatory; n. a person who currently holds a particular position
trenchantadj. keen and forceful; caustic
bivouacn. temporary encampment, often in an unsheltered area
vituperativeadj. harshly critical
vitiatev. to make faulty or impure; to spoil
turpituden. immoral behavior
vignetten. a small design or portrait; a brief scene (as from a movie) or literary sketch
contentiousadj. always ready to argue; quarrelsome
laityn. all the people not belonging to a given profession, esp. the clergy
altercationn. a heated or noisy argument
variegatedadj. distinctly marked with different colors; diverse
deludev. to make someone believe something that is untrue; to deceive
balefuladj. harmful or threatening harm or evil
doggedadj. refusing to give up despite difficulties
regressv. to return for a previous state
manumitv. to grant freedom to slaves; to emancipate
affectedadj. behaving in an artificial way to impress people
quailv. to draw back in fear; lose heart of courage
obstinateadj. unreasonably stubborn
repertoiren. the range of pieces an artist is prepared to perform
quotidianadj. daily; customary
disparateadj. entirely unlike
imputev. to assign credit, often of guilt or blame
paucityn. smallness of number; scarcity
noisomeadj. disgustingly offensive; foul
tablev. to postpone consideration of
tillv. to prepare the soil for planting
gustatoryadj. relating to the sense of taste
maudlinadj. excessively sentimental
congenialadj. suited to one's needs or nature; friendly; sympathetic
privationn. lack of basic necessities
impetuousadj. characterized by sudden emotion, energy, etc.; impulsive and passionate
invectiven. language that abuses or denounces
patronizev. to sponsor or support; to be kind or helpful in a snobbish way, as if dealing with an inferior
poignantadj. sharply painful to the feelings
toadyn. a person who flatters others for self-serving reasons; a sycophant
compendiumn. a short, complete summary
redolentadj. aromatic; fragrant; suggestive
perfunctoryadj. done without care or interest or merely as a form or routine
dowdyadj. lacking in neatness or style; shabby
canonn. a law or body of laws, esp. religious; an established principle or basis for judgement; The works of a writer that have been accepted as authentic
ocularadj. relating to the eye or sense of sight
juntan. a group of military officers ruling a country after seizing power
colludev. to plot secretly for a deceitful or illegal purposee
husbandv. to use sparingly; to conserve
accruev. to come as a gain; to increase
kudosn. glory; fame
mellifluousadj. smooth and sweet; flowing with sweetness
convivialadj. sociable; festive
oppugnv. to oppose with argument; to contradict or call into question
gesticulatev. to make gestures, esp. while speaking
flotsamn. wreckage of a ship or its cargo found floating on the sea
manifoldadj. of many kinds; numerous and varied
tacitadj. unspoken but understood; silent
implacableadj. unable to be pacified; relentless
maledictionn. evil talk about someone; slander; a curse
raconteurn. one who tells stories with skill
inchoateadj. at an early stage of development; not well developed
diffidentadj. lacking self-confidence; timid; shy
musev. to meditate; to consider thoughtfully
condonev. to pardon or overlook voluntarily
covertadj. concealed or disguised; not openly practiced
adulteratev. to make impure
etherealadj. delicate; soft; airy; intangible
anthropologyn. study of the origin, behavior, and culture of human beings
extantadj. currently or actually existing
blandishmentn. a flattering act or remark; allurement; enticement
unpretentiousadj. modest; not showy
weatherv. to survive
insensibleadj. not able to feel or perceive; unresponsive
commensurateadj. equal in proportion; having the same size, duration, etc.
salientadj. important, prominent, most noticeable
recidivistn. one who returns to criminal habits
venaladj. capable of being bribed or corrupted
palliatev. to lessen the pain or severity
lacunan. an empty space or missing portion
opinev. to express an opinion
firebrandn. one who stirs up trouble or revolt
jeremiadn. an elaborate and lengthy tale of sadness
reproachv. to express disapproval for a fault, usu. out of sense of disappointment
largessn. generosity in giving gifts
martyrn. one who chooses to die rather than to give up religious beliefs, or who suffers greatly to further a cause
ephemeraladj. lasting for a short time; fleeting
ignominyn. shame; dishonor
flightyadj. unstable or easily excited
duressn. strain or hardship, often illegally applied
creditv. to believe; to trust
anachronismn. something not belonging to a certain time period
legerdemainn. trickery; deception; sleight of hand
precipitateadj. moving rapidly and without caution
vocationn. a regular occupation, esp. one for which a person is particularly suited
meanadj. lowly, insignificant, petty
temperateadj. consistent; moderate; without extremes
gestatev. evolve, as in prenatal growth
garishadj. marked by unpleasantly bright colors or excessive ornamentation
patinan. thing greenish layer that forms on copper as a result of corrosion; the sheen on any surface produced by age or use
preponderancen. superiority in weight, force, importance or influence
hideboundadj. narrow-minded
obtuseadj. slow in understanding; dull; stupid
penitentadj. feeling regret
evanescentadj. fading from sight; transient
mercurialadj. easily changeable; erratic
lionizev. to look upon or treat as a celebrity
palatableadj. pleasant or acceptable to the taste
insularadj. narrow in outlook; provincial
garrulousadj. talking too much, esp. about trivial things
cavortv. to leap about in a lively manner; to have lively or boisterous fun
epigramn. a short, cleverly-worded statement
alacrityn. cheerful willingness; swiftness
hedonistn. someone who seeks only pleasure
foiblen. a minor weakness of character
gamutn. an entire range or series
heydayn. a time or success or popularity
fiatn. an authoritative order; an arbitrary decree
fraternizev. to associate in a friendly manner
attritionn. gradual reduction
flaccidadj. lacking firmness
autocracyn. rule by one person with unlimited power
sumptuousadj. of a size of splendor suggesting great expense; lavish
myopicadj. near-sighted
hirsuteadj. having excessive body hair
purveyv. to supply
moresn. accepted rules of behavior
filibusterv. to use a prolonged speech to delay legislative action; n. a speech that delays legislative action
lambentadj. flickering, e.g., of a flame or light reflected on a surface
obeisancen. a gesture, such as curtsy, that expresses respect or obedience
camaraderien. loyalty; a warm, friendly feeling among members of a group
dirgen. slow, sad music, esp. a funeral hymn
unseemlyadj. not decent or proper
didacticadj. intended to teach; inclined to teach excessively
disabusev. to free from error or falsehood
eddyn. a current, as of water or air, moving contrary to the direction of the main current, esp. in a circular motion
gambitn. a calculated, risky opening move
savantn. a well-educated person; a scholar
preceptn. a rule of action or conduct
querulousadj. inclined to find fault; complaining; full of complaint
hearsayn. rumor; gossip
adon. trouble; fuss
macabreadj. suggesting the horror of death
redoubtableadj. fearsome; formidable
impassen. a dead-end
unctuousadj. oily; showing insincere earnestness
aggrandizev. to enlarge; increase in size, power or rank
sylvanadj. characteristic of woods or forests
blaseadj. indifferent or bored with life; unimpressed as if because of too much worldly experience
stultifyv. to make absurdly useless, esp. by degrading; to make appear foolish
torpidadj. inactive; sluggish; dormant
adjunctn. something attached to another in a subordinate position
subjugatev. to bring under control; to conquer
spuriousadj. not genuine; false
acquitv. to declare free of guilt; to clear
undulatev. to move in a wave-like motion
paroxysmn. a sudden convulsion or outburst; a fit
moguln. a rich or powerful person
burnishv. to polish
exhumev. to dig up out of the ground
conflagrationn. large, disastrous fire
digestn. a collection of previously published material, usu. In condensed form
travailn. painfully difficult work; pain or suffering from mental or physical hardship
quiescentadj. inactive, oft. Suggesting a temporary state
uncouthadj. uncultured; crude
tightfistedadj. stingy; miserly
purloinv. to steal, oft. In violation of a trust
impotentadj. powerless; helpless; ineffective
virulentadj. extremely infectious or harmful; bitterly hostile
assiduousadj. diligent; hard-working; constant
inceptionn. commencement; beginning; origin
surfeitn. an excess
petulantadj. impatient or irritable, esp. over a minor annoyance
calumnyn. a false and maclicious statement; slander
irkv. to irritate or be wearisome
emaciatedadj. made thin unnaturally; abnormally thin due to starvation
confoundv. to mix up or lump together indiscriminately; to confuse
leonineadj. authoritative; commanding; like a lion
emanatev. to send forth; to come forth
douradj. stern and humorless; silently ill-humored
dregsn. the worst part; the sediment in a liquid
bunglev. to handle badly; to botch or mess up
dogmaticadj. arrogantly asserting unproved principles
inconsequentialadj. unimportant
humusn. fertilizer; black soil for fertilizing
convolutedadj. intricate; complicated
protegen. one whose welfare, training, or career is promoted by another person
temperv. to bring down in tone; to moderate; to soften
propitiateadj. to appease or placate
abeyancen. a suspension of activity
waywardadj. stubbornly going against what is expected or required in order to satisfy one's own desires
profligateadj. immorally wasteful
abhorv. to detest; to shrink from in disgust
stalwartadj. firm and resolute; having imposing physical strength
senescentadj. aging; growing weak with age
scheman. an outline or model, often drawn as a diagram
impertinentadj. rude
sybariten. one devoted to luxury
asceticadj. self-denying
martinetn. one who is strict in discipline, and enjoys authority too much
aquilineadj. resembling or relating to eagles; curved (like an eagle's beak)
hoveln. a living place that is very filthy and dirty
incarceratev. to restrict by imprisonment; to keep in prison
bandyv. to pass (gossip, rumor, etc.) about freely and carelessly
anodynen. a pain-killer or anesthetic
beguilev. to deceive by charm
litigantn. one who is engaged in a lawsuit
upbraidv. to criticize sharply, esp. by a figure of authority
stringentadj. imposing strict standards of performance; constricted
spectern. a ghost; a disturbing image or prospect
resuscitatev. to revive, esp. from apparent death or unconsciousness
superciliousadj. feeling or showing proud contempt
sanctimoniousadj. pretending holiness; hyprocritically devout
pusillanimousadj. cowardly
besetv. to attack from all sides; to trouble persistently
revilev. to attack with harsh language
despondentadj. so sad as to lack all hope
torridadj. parched with heat; ardent or passionate
foddern. feed for livestock; a resource
deemv. to have as an opinion; to consider
inculcatev. to teach or impress by frequent repetition; to instill
despoilv. to deprive something of value
captiousadj. critically faultfinding
inveterateadj. established for a long time; habitual
laconicadj. brief in speech; using few words
obstreperousadj. noisily and stubbornly defiant
edificen. a building; architectural monument
squalidadj. having a dirty or lowly appearance
circumspectadj. showing discretion and careful judgment
perniciousadj. very harmful or destructive
cavalieradj. casual, disdainful
incipientadj. beginning to appear or be noticed
recriminationn. a reply to one charge with a countercharge
utilitarianadj. stressing practical use over other values
reparteen. a quick witty reply; a series of such replies
taxv. to make difficult or excessive demands upon
recalcitrantadj. marked by stubborn defiance of authority or guidance
amenableadj. responsive to advice or authority
vestigen. a trace of something that once existed but has disappeared
rampantadj. unrestrained
reprievev. to postpone or cancel punishment
connivev. to cooperate secretly in wrongful action
scintillan. a small amount; a spark
castigatev. to criticize severely, esp. in public
consignv. to give to the care of another; to set apart
insouciantadj. calm and untroubled; carefree; indifferent;
accoladen. an award or honor; a sign of great respect
iren. anger
subsumev. to include as part of a larger group
importunev. to beg desperately and repeatedly
stridentadj. loud and shrill or grating
penuryn. lack of money, property, necessities
enclaven. a country or other distinctly bounded area wholly surrounded by another area
iconoclastn. one who attacks and seeks to destroy widely accepted ideas
pallidadj. faint in color; pale
excoriatev. to denounce sharply; to tear or wear the skin off
burgeonv. to sprout or grow rapidly
bevyn. a group, esp. of women or birds
nonplusv. to put at a loss what to do or think
ensconcev. to settle securely or snugly
renegev. to fail to carry out a promise
desecratev. to violate the religious quality of something
neologismn. new word of phrase
catharsisn. purging of the emotions
conduciveadj. tending to be bring about
interlocutorn. someone who takes part in a conversation, esp. formally
dilettanten. one who engages an art with only superficial skill; an amateur
expositionn. a statement intended to give background information or to explain something difficult
matriculatev. to admit or be admitted into a group, esp. a college or university
fulsomeadj. disgusting because excessive or insincere; replusive
factiousadj. causing dissension
espousev. to give loyalty or support to; to adopt
countenancen. appearance, esp. the expression of the face; v. to tolerate
fecklessadj. careless; irresponsible
epicuren. one with refined tastes, esp. in food and wine
contravenev. to act counter to; violate
imbroglion. a confused misunderstanding or disagreement
dichotomyn. division with two contradictory parts
obdurateadj. not easily moved to pity or sympathy
debilitatedadj. showing impairment of energy or strength
demurv. to object; to disagree with something
effacev. to rub out, as from a surface; to erase
libertineadj. one who lives an immoral life
abstruseadj. difficult to understand
aegisn. a protection; sponsorship
coercev. to force by threat or intimidation
depreciatev. to reduce in price or value
routn. a disorderly retreat or flight following a defeat; an overwhelming defeat; v. to defeat overwhelmingly
fetterv. to confine, to restrain, or keep down; n. chains; shackles
ownv. to admit, esp. taking personal responsibility for one's own actions or thoughts
lachrymoseadj. causing tears; weeping or inclined to weep
paeann. a song of joy, triumph, or praise
decadencen. a period of decline, as in morals
contingentadj. unpredictable because dependent on chance; dependent on something uncertain
debaclen. an overwhelming defeat or rout
reproofn. an expression of disapproval; a rebuke
emphaticadj. done or expressed with force
ineluctableadj. unable to be avoided; inescapable
disinterestedadj. free from bias
emblematicadj. symbolic, representative of more
juncturen. a point of time; a concurrence of events
nettlev. to bother; to irritate
begetv. to produce; to father offspring
appellationn. name; title
invidiousadj. tending to arouse hostility or resentment
deadpanadj. showing no expression
tautologyn. needless repetition of an idea in different words (e.g., "widow woman")
cravenadj. cowardly; contemptibly timid
quintessencen. a pure substance or essence of something
extolv. to praise highly and lavishly
jocularadj. characterized by joking
incarnateadj. in human form and shape
obviatev. to stop from occurring; to prevent or make unnecessary
linchpinn. a central element that holds other parts together
tribulationn. great misery or distress
acrimonyn. bitter, shape hostility in speech or behavior
dauntv. to make afraid; intimidate
bilkv. to swindle; to cheat
fitfuladj, occurring in irregular outbursts; occurring in spurts
conspicuousadj. easy to notice; obvious; apparent
adventn. a coming or an arrival, esp. of something very important
triflen. something that lacks significance or worth
exactv. to demand and obtain by force or authority
grandiloquentadj, using excessively fancy or pompous words
cachetn. a mark of distinction
extenuatev. to lessen the seriousness of, esp. by giving partial excuses
manifeston. a public declaration of principles, often political
bequeathv. to pass down to; to hand down, esp. in a will
disaffectedadj. resentful and rebellious, esp. against authority
perfidiousadj, marked by extreme treachery
deprecatev. to express disapproval of
erstwhileadj. former; of an earlier time
effigyn. a representation of a person or group used esp. to demonstrate hatred
educev. to draw out; elicit
gainsayv. to deny; declare false
odiousadj. arousing strong dislike or disgust
intransigentadj, refusing to compromise or agree
adroitadj. naturally skillful, esp. dealing with difficult circumstances
dilatoryadj. characterized by delay; tardy
cupidityn, strong desire for wealth; greed
fraughtadj. full of a particular quality
auspiciousadj. marked by favorable circumstances
officiousadj. interfering; trying to give unwanted advice
colloquyn. conversation, esp. a formal one
rapportn. concord; trustful relationship; harmony
overtadj. open; not hidden
quandaryn. a state of uncertainty, esp. about what course of action to take
plasticadj. capable of being shaped or molded; easily influenced
comportv. to conduct or behave oneself; to be compatible in agreement with
attenuatev. to make thin; to reduce in force
mordantadj. bitingly sarcastic
appropriatev. to set apart for a specific use; to take possession of, often without permission
indolentadj. lazy
iniquityn. extreme immorality or injustice; wickedness
indelibleadj. incapable of being removed or erased
apotheosisn. the ideal example; the elevation of a person to the rank of a god
qualifyv. to modify, limit, or restrict, as by giving exceptions
mendaciousadj. lying; false, esp. habitually
sanctifyv. to make holy; to make legitimate or binding
factitiousadj. produced artificially; not genuine
leviathann. something enormous and powerful; a sea monster
forbearv. to be patient or avoid doing
avant-garden. a group active in inventing and applying new techniques, esp. in the arts
occasionv. to cause; to provide an appropriate opportunity for
bombastn. pompous speech
volitionn. a conscious choice or decision
propoundv. to suggest for consideration; to propose
retrenchv. to reduce, esp. expenses
philistinen. a narrow-minded person with no interest in the arts
prolixadj. wordy and tedious
soporificadj. promoting sleep
pretextn. an excuse; a strategy intended to conceal something
supplicatev. to request with great humility, as though by praying
escapaden. a reckless adventure
abstemiousadj. moderate, especially in eating and drinking
flounderv. to proceed with clumsiness and confusion
marshalv. to arrange in order
timbren. the distinguishing quality of a sound
drossn. impurities formed on the surface of metals during melting; worthless, commonplace or trivial material
charlatann. a fake; one who pretends to have expert knowledge
misogynyn. hatred of women
putativeadj. put forth or accepted as true on inadequate grounds; supposed
gnarledadj. twisted; knotty
remissadj. careless in, or negligent about, attending to a task
impingev. to have an effect on something, esp. a negative one; to encroach
anthropocentricadj. interpreting everything in terms of human experience and values
arbitratev. to settle a dispute or a fight between two parties
declaimv. to recite a speech, poem etc; to announce formally
obfuscatev. to make difficult to understand; to make indistinct
clemencyn. mercy, or leniency towards an offender
tomen. a large, orten scholarly book
apocryphaladj. probably untrue or true; of questionable authorship
seminaladj. original and inspiring further similar efforts
cavalcaden. an order of events; a procession
lexicographern. a person who writes or compiles dictionaries
mot justen. exactly the right word or expression
compunctionn. a feeling uneasiness caused by a sense of guilt
sequesterv. to move or set apart; to quarantine
tendentiousadj. having a bias; favoring a cause (usually in print)
felicitousadj. well chosen; appropriate
stricturen. a restraint or limit
turgidadj. swollen, as from fluid; excessively ornate or complex in style
philandern. of a man, to engage in sexual affairs, esp. casually
discursiveadj. covering a wide range of subjects; rambling
ingratiatev. to bring oneself into another's favor or good graces by conscious effort
nexusn. a connection or intersection
denigratev. to disgrace a reputation; to blacken; to belittle
stymiev. to obstruct; to stump
uproariousadj. extremely funny
modicumn. a small quantity
unconscionableadj. beyond reason; not restrained by conscience
procrusteanadj. showing merciless disregard for individual differences or special circumstances
serendipityn. unexpected gift or discovery
callowadj. inexperienced; not developed; immature
cavilv. to argue in a petty fashion; make trifling objections
thespianadj. relating to drama; n. an actor
philologyn. literary study, esp. as it involves the editing of texts and the history of languages
consternationn. a sudden feeling of anxiety, shock, or confusion
veneern. an attractive, ultimately misleading outward show; thin layer
salaciousadj. lustful; obscene
pastichen. something (esp. a work of art, literature, or music) created from many different sources
fatalisticadj. believing that all events are predestined and unavoidable
prevaricaten. to avoid telling the truth
daisn. raised platform
limpidadj. perfectly clear; transparent
anthropomorphismn. the attribution of human characteristics to animals or inanimate objects
triteadj. worn out, used too often
cogentadj. appealing forcibly to the mind; convincing
satev. to satisfy (any appetite or desire) fully
disingenuousadj. not straightforward or candid; crafty
weltern. a confused mass or jumble
evincev. to give outward evidence of; to display clearly
prognosisn. the anticipated progress of recovery
virtuoson. one with great skill, esp. in music or the arts
whetv. to sharpen; to make keen
fopn. a man who is preoccupied with his clothes and manners
meretriciousadj. attracting attention in a vulgar way
exhortv. to urge strongly
abjectadj. of the lowest degree, brought low in condition
winsomeadj. charming, esp. in a childlike or innocent way
allayv. to reduce the intensity of; to calm
eponymn. a person after whom a place, people, disease, etc. is named
pluckyadj. showing courage in unfavorable circumstances
opulencen. extreme wealth; luxuriousness; abundance
galvanizev. to rouse; stir; spur
ebullientadj. in high spirits; boiling or seeming to boil
turbidadj. cloudy, muddy; in a state of turmoil
complicityn. association or participation in a wrongful act
seemlyadj. proper or fitting with respect to established customs
carpv. to complain; to seek fault, esp. over unimportant matters
repastn. a meal
trepidationn. strong fear or dread marked by trembling or hesitancy
impetusn. an impelling or originating force
rescindv. to take back or cancel
miasman. a noxious or poisonous atmosphere
tortuousadj. winding, twisted
baroqueadj. fantastically over-decorated; gaudily ornate
proprietyn. good manners; proper behavior
sacrosanctadj. very sacred, holy, or inviolable
quaffv. to drink quickly or with enthusiasm
prostrateadj. lying face down, esp. as asign of humility or worship; physically or emotionally exhausted
eke outv. to add to with difficulty; to make just enough to continue
chicaneryn. deception by trickery
